Php oop crud tutorial php object oriented programming. In this article i am going to show you how to programmatically retrieve data from a mysql database using the mysqldataadapter and the mysqldatareader classes. Try to upload any filespdf, doc, exe, video, mp3, zip,etc. So far you have learnt how to create database and table as well as inserting data. Php code how to search data in mysql database by id using. In this php tutorial we are explaining how to fetch data from a mysql database and print result as a html table. This tutorial is intended for developers who have already written code to get data in and out of a mysql database, but who wish to discover if there are any benefits of adopting an object oriented approach. In this example, we read mysql table data by using php. Pdo is object oriented with all the benefits coming with this. These few simple steps to fetch data from database in php and mysql. Php what is oop php classesobjects php constructor php destructor php access modifiers php inheritance php constants php abstract classes php traits php static methods php static properties mysql database mysql database mysql connect mysql create db mysql create table mysql insert data mysql get last id mysql insert multiple mysql prepared. Php crud operations using php oop and mysql phpgurukul.
Welcome to a tutorial on how to search and display data from database in php. Using php objects to access your database tables part 1 tony marstons blog about software. Delete data from mysql table using oop in php webslesson. Now we are going to fetch uploaded files from mysql database, data. Start by creating an html form with a search textbox and submit button. Both these classes are available once you install the mysql connector for. Retrieve or fetch the data from the mysql database in php. For retrieve data from mysql, the select statement is used. In this tutorial i will show you that how to perform and use object oriented programming in php with mysql to select and insert data. This code will get the current page number with the help of. In this video you can find how to retrieve data from mysql table using php object oriented programming concept and display data on webpage in table formate. This example demonstrates to you how you can easily get or fetch the data from the database using mysql queries in php. You will be creating a simple rest api that supports get, post, put and delete requests and allow you to perform crud operations against a mysql database to create, read, update and delete records from a database.
You dont want an attacker trying to attack your system by submitting improper form data. Fpdf is a php class which allows to generate pdf files with php, that is to say. Select or fetch data from mysql table using oops in php. You are going to see how to convert mysql data into pdf using fpdf library. In this tutorial display data from mysql database using php, jquery and datatable we are going to learn about how to display the data from database using datatable. Display data from mysql database using php, jquery and. Php pdo crud tutorial using oop with bootstrap coding cage. By creating a mysql crud class you can easily create, read, update and delete entries in any of your projects, regardless of how the database is designed.
Using objects i will show you how to create a database object using the singleton design pattern, and also use objects based on tables to insert, update, and select data from the database. An object is a selfsustainable construct that enables reusability of code. Learn object oriented programming oop in php preamble the hardest thing to learn and teach btw, in object oriented php is the basics. It uses two arguments first argument as offset and second argument the number of records which will be returned from the database. It is telling the database in which encoding you are sending the data in and would like to get the data back. Php mysql using mysqli using mysqli objectoriented mysql improved to connect to mysql server. How to display data from database table in phpmysql using. Its just basic oop object oriented programming really. After reading lots of articles i decided to create my first project. To make sure your strings go from php to mysql as utf8, make sure your database and tables.
Retrieving data from a mysql database dave on csharp. After publishing that article we received many requests from our readers for php crud tutorial with pdo extension and mysql. Build professional php applications with object oriented programming. We have already seen basic crud example using php and mysql. Using oops in php its become so easy to manage and perform such operations like insert and select data from mysql tables, so lets have a look. Php mysql insert into insert data in mysql table with mysqli object, insert into query. We can retrieve data from a specific column or all columns of a table. Php has a very complete set of objectoriented programming.
How to submit an html form to a mysql database using php. In this tutorial, we will learn how to fetch data from database in php. Now every sellers and buyers needs invoice system to handle billing online. And on another note, you shouldnt need to encapsulate this code into a class. How to search and display data from database in php code. In previous post i explained how to insert data using oops concepts. In this tutorial you learn how to develop crud operation with php and mysql using object oriented programming oop technique. Php database abstraction layer pdo php data objects. In this tutorial i explains how to generate pdf from mysql data using php. The grid view of the table is very important for web component in the modern website. In this example, i have used the objectoriented method for implementing crud functionalities.
Ive opted to show you how oop works with a reallife example, for a programmer. Validating input data is crucial to any php application. Object oriented crud operation with php and mysql phpzag. Php already provides oopbased database classes called pdo, or php data objects. Database crud is one of a common functional pack that is required to manage and manipulate data of an entity based application. In this tutorial we are simply creating an html from with select name and label tags. Using php objects to access your database tables part 1. Alias functions are provided for backward compatibility purposes only. Object oriented programming oop oop is a design philosophy that uses objects and methods rather than linear concepts of procedures and tasks procedural programming to accomplish programmatic goals. How to fetch data from database in php display data in. It supports the procedural and object oriented programming paradigm. An easytoread, quick reference for php best practices, accepted. Ive been a freelance web developer for over 12 years.
As earlier post i have make one class in which i have already describe how to. How to generate pdf from mysql data using php phpgurukul. Php oop crud operations using pdo extension and mysql. How to file upload and view with php and mysql coding cage. Using oop php to select, update, and insert data in a. Through this way we can get data autofill data in html form. Php is a popular web scripting language, and is often used to create database driven web sites. In this tutorial you will learn how to develop invoice and billing system using php and mysql.
Dual procedural and objectoriented interface manual. Phpmyadmin will create all of the necessary tablesimport some test data for you to play with. Learning php, mysql, javascript, and css fsu college of. In the earlier article, weve already published php crud functionality tutorial using ajax.
Note that due to initially limited support of unicode in the utf8 mysql charset, it is now recommended to use utf8mb4 instead. The tutorial explained in easy steps with live demo to handle create, read, update and delete functionality into mysql database with employee data using php oop. Well, it actually really isnt that difficult in the simplest design. In this tutorial we will see that how to create database crud operations using object oriented concept in pdo with bootstrap framework, i have used here bootstrap framework for frontend design and the mysql database operations will done by pdo and oop, recently i have posted pagination tutorial using pdo and oop and one of my blog reader request me to post that how to use oop. So here is the complete step by step tutorial for php insert drop down list selected value.
Php is used for creating interactive and dynamic web pages quickly and can access a wide range of relational database management systems such as mysql, postgresql, and sqlite. Previously, we learned how to create or insert, read, update and delete database records with our php and mysql crud tutorial for beginners. Learn php 7, mysql, objectoriented programming, php forms. This is a simple php oop crud tutorial with a database application. Now its time to retrieve data what have inserted in the preceding tutorial.
In this tutorial, we are going to learn on how to display data from database table in php mysql using pdo query. Fortunately, the php developers have provided some help with that process. So if youre looking for invoice or billing system using php and mysql, then youre here at right place. Php oop php pdo my first project, am i doing right. Can you post some tutorial to prevent sql injection with php oop and pdo. Numerous examples from robots to bicycles have been offered as easy explanations of what oop is.
Before proceeding with this tutorial, you should have a basic understanding of. How to upload, insert, update and delete file using php. But once you get them underyourbelt, the rest will come much, much easier. You know about mysql database, which is used to store data write, and php is an oop object oriented programming language programing language. Php retrieve data from mysql database and display tuts. Phpmysql free course, online tutorials php mysql code.
Membuat crud dengan oop php dan mysql malas ngoding. This post about how to fetch data from database using oops concept in php. Once youre ready, lets get started learning php object oriented. How to make pdf invoices from database in php php fpdf. This tutorial helps you get started with php and oracle database by showing how to build a web application and by giving techniques for using php with oracle. In this tutorial youll learn how to select records from a mysql table using php. Perform sql queries to create a database and tables.
How to connect to mysql using pdo treating php delusions. Fetching data from a mysql database and print result as a. Now after that we are submitting the current drop down list selected item directly into mysql db table on submit button click. The procedural interface is similar to that of the old mysql extension. Pdo is a php extension that provides an interface for accessing databases in php. You can use this source code to merge the last tutorial that i made and its called registration form in php mysql using pdo query this source code will help us on how to show data from the database using pdo query.
There weve using mysqli to connect database and database related operations. Follow these simple steps to create pagination in php 1. How to select data from mysql database tables using php. Mysql s limit clause helps us to create a pagination feature. And then we are calling fpdf functions to generate pdf from this mysql data. They also mentioned that they are waiting for our tutorial because complete and clear php mysql. All the sample php code examples are also included for creating a database connection for mysql database. Due to its simplicity and ease of use, php is a widelyused open source generalpurpose scripting language.